The present debate on Ireland’s Corporation Tax rate is political grandstanding on the part of our European colleagues, the European Court of Justice in the leading case in the area is very clear.

Political grandstanding

“Member States, due to the principle of fiscal sovereignty and in the absence of harmonisation, are free to adopt whatever tax system they wished and, in particular, to set the associated tax rates and tax bases.”
